This is a question about the task 8.2 of IEWB 10 valume 1.
I will paraphrase the question so those who do not have the
current verison of IEWB can have an idea about I am talking
about.

The question is asking to configure two routers R3 and R4
so that 200Kbps of VoIP traffic always get dequeued first when
it is sent over the FR.

F3 --FR cloud-- F4
FR circuit is provisioned at 256kbps and both routers are
already configured to conform to this rate.

My answer to this question is as follows.

###my answer###
class-map match-all voip
match protocol vofr

policy-map voip-p
class voip
priority 200

map-class frame-relay DLCI403
service-policy output voip-p

(config for the other router is omitted)
###end-of-my-answer###

But the solution guide says

###solution guide answer###
ip access-list extended voip-a
permit udp any any range 16384 32767

class-map match-all voip
match access-groupname voip-a

policy-map voip-p
class voip
priority 200

map-class frame-relay
frame-relay mincir 256000
service-poilcy output voip-p
###end of solution guide's answer###

My question,

1. Is the traffic matched by the statement "match protocol vofr" different
from
the traffic match by the ACL "permit udp any any range 16384 32767"?

2. Why is it necessary to configure "frame-relay mincir 256000"?
